San Diego State University (SDSU) is a public research university with an acceptance rate of 34%. San Diego State University is part of the California State University system. The 293-acre campus is located on the northeastern edge of the city. The college ranks highly for study abroad, and...

The University of the Pacific is a private university with an acceptance rate of 66%. Located on a 175-acre campus in Stockton, California, the University of the Pacific is an easy drive to San Francisco, Sacramento, Yosemite, and Lake Tahoe. Popular undergraduate majors include business, biol...
